Harris County Office of Homeland Security & Emergency Management Honored at EMAT Leadership Symposium

0

The Harris County Office of Homeland Security & Emergency Management (HCOHSEM) was lauded at the recent Emergency Management Association of Texas (EMAT) Leadership Symposium held in San Marcos, Texas. HCOHSEM clinched the prestigious Excellence in Emergency Management Award for its pioneering 2023 EM Impact program.

The groundbreaking EM Impact initiative unfolded from June 27 to June 28, 2023, attracting fifteen aspiring young women eager to delve into the realm of emergency management. Designed to spotlight emergency management, diversity, equity, and women’s empowerment, the program resonated as a beacon of opportunity for future leaders in the field.

Deputy Coordinator of HCOHSEM, Mel Bartis, expressed gratitude for the recognition, emphasizing the pivotal role of the program in shaping the next generation of emergency management professionals. “The young women who attended EM Impact are the next generation of emergency managers, and we are excited to help prepare them to be our future colleagues,” Bartis remarked.

During the event, participants delved into various career avenues within disaster response and emergency management, honed leadership acumen, and forged connections with accomplished women in the field. Engaging panels showcased experts from diverse emergency management domains, including public information, geographical information systems, and education.

Upon program completion, attendees gleaned invaluable skills and resources vital for their educational and professional odyssey. Furthermore, they cultivated mentorship bonds and fortified personal and professional networks within their cohort, setting the stage for future collaboration. EM Impact is slated to become an annual fixture, promising sustained empowerment for budding emergency management leaders.

The EMAT Leadership Symposium, which drew over 270 attendees this year, underscores EMAT’s unwavering commitment to advancing emergency management both statewide and nationally. As a stalwart advocate for the emergency management fraternity, EMAT spearheads initiatives aimed at fostering a robust statewide emergency management agenda and nurturing the professional growth of emergency management practitioners.

Princess Kate Reveals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ment

In a heartfelt video message released on Friday, Princess Kate of Wales disclosed her ongoing battle with cancer. The announcement comes two months after she underwent what she described as “major” abdominal surgery. The 42-year-old Princess, wife of Prince William, is currently undergoing chemotherapy, with the exact type of cancer remaining undisclosed.

Speaking from Windsor in the video filmed on Wednesday, Princess Kate expressed her shock at the diagnosis, emphasizing her and William’s efforts to manage the situation privately for the sake of their young family. The cancer was discovered during post-operative tests following her surgery in mid-January.

Although initially believed to be non-cancerous, further tests revealed the presence of cancer, prompting Princess Kate’s medical team to recommend preventative chemotherapy. Despite the challenges, she expressed gratitude for the support of her husband and the importance of privacy during this time.

The announcement coincides with the public acknowledgment of her father-in-law, King Charles, also undergoing cancer treatment. While the type of cancer and treatment remain undisclosed for both individuals, British Prime Minister Rishi Sunak noted that the king’s cancer was “caught early.”

Princess Kate affirmed her commitment to returning to official duties once cleared by her medical team, while also sending a message of hope and solidarity to others facing similar battles against cancer. She urged individuals not to lose faith or hope, emphasizing that they are not alone in their struggles.

Former President Trump Struggles to Secure Bond for Massive New York Fraud Case

Former President Donald Trump faces challenges in finding an insurance company willing to underwrite his bond to cover the substantial judgment against him in the New York attorney general’s civil fraud case, as revealed by his legal team to a New York appeals court.

According to Trump’s lawyers, he has approached approximately 30 underwriters to secure the bond, which is required by the end of this month. The judgment, including interest, surpasses $464 million, making it daunting for bonding companies to consider such a substantial bond.

Trump’s attorneys highlighted the difficulty of obtaining the bond in full, indicating that potential underwriters are demanding cash rather than properties as collateral.

Trump’s legal team has requested the appeals court to delay the posting of the bond until the completion of his appeal, citing the substantial value of Trump’s properties compared to the judgment amount. Additionally, they seek a postponement until the appeal reaches New York’s highest court if the appeals court rules unfavorably.

Trump expressed his concerns regarding the feasibility of posting the bond, branding it “practically impossible.” In a post on Truth Social, he criticized the size of the bond as unprecedented and beyond the capabilities of any company, including his own.

Last month, Trump was ordered by New York Judge Arthur Engoron to pay $355 million in disgorgement in a civil fraud case brought by New York Attorney General Letitia James. Engoron ruled that Trump and his co-defendants, including his adult sons, were liable for fraud and conspiracy, alleging they inflated the value of Trump’s assets to secure favorable loan and insurance rates.

Trump’s appeal process could extend over several years, during which time the bond would be held in an account. While Trump posted a $91.6 million bond earlier this month for his appeal in the E. Jean Carroll defamation case, challenges remain in securing the larger bond required for the civil fraud case.

According to Alan Garten, the top legal officer of the Trump Organization, major underwriters, including Chubb, have limitations on accepting real estate as collateral, posing a significant obstacle to obtaining the bond.

Despite the hurdles, Trump’s campaign spokesman Steven Cheung criticized the size of the fraud judgment, denouncing it as an abuse of the law and vowing Trump’s continued fight against what he termed as “Crooked Joe Biden-directed hoaxes.”

Houston City Council Greenlights $2.5 Billion Terminal B Upgrade Project at Bush Intercontinental Airport

Houston City Council unanimously approved a significant agreement on March 20 to advance a $2.5 billion redevelopment project for Terminal B at George Bush Intercontinental Airport, in collaboration with United Airlines.

The project, which aims to revitalize Terminal B, had faced a delay of approximately five months due to concerns raised by the city controller’s office regarding financial terms and design plans for the redevelopment.

The approval process spanned two mayoral administrations, beginning with former Mayor Sylvester Turner and former Controller Chris Brown, and continuing under Mayor John Whitmire and Controller Chris Hollins, who assumed office in January.

Mayor Whitmire included the item on the agenda for the first time during his administration on March 6, signaling his commitment to advancing the project. Controller Hollins allowed the vote to proceed on March 20, leading to unanimous approval by council members of the initial part of the agreement.

The approved agreement will allocate $150 million from the Airport System Consolidated 2011 Construction Fund for a Memorandum of Agreement between the city and United Airlines.

The $2.5 billion expansion project is set to triple the capacity of Terminal B, including the addition of two new gate concourses, 22 domestic gates, upgrades to the south gate concourse, a new ticket and baggage hall, expanded curbs, a new baggage system, enhanced security checkpoints, and additional amenities.

In terms of financing, the city of Houston will contribute $624 million to the project in three installments, each requiring separate council approval. Melissa Dubowski, Houston’s Financial Director, outlined the financing components, which include special facility revenue bonds secured by lease payments from United and general airport revenue bonds.

United Airlines will cover the remaining $1.9 billion of the project cost.

Looking ahead, a feasibility study is currently underway and will be finalized before the issuance of special facility revenue bonds. An inducement resolution, indicating official intent, is scheduled for City Council consideration on March 27.

The issuance of special facility revenue bonds will necessitate council action, expected to occur in late spring. It is anticipated that these bonds will be issued in one or more series between late summer 2024 and summer 2025, with pricing and project closure estimated to take place between 2024 and 2026, according to a council presentation.

Harris County Police Issue Warning After Rise in “Bank Jugging” Robberies

0

Harris County authorities are cautioning residents following a surge in a concerning crime trend known as “bank jugging,” where individuals are targeted immediately after leaving a bank or financial institution.

According to detectives, several recent incidents involved suspects monitoring victims who withdrew substantial amounts of cash from banks. Subsequently, the suspects trailed the victims as they departed. Upon the victims parking their vehicles elsewhere, leaving the withdrawn cash unattended, the perpetrators would strike. Typically, they would break car windows and seize the money.

In one incident on Sept. 15 at 3:13 p.m., a victim withdrew $9,500 from a local bank. As the victim drove away, their tire pressure sensor illuminated. Upon inspection, the victim discovered a punctured tire. An unknown individual approached, offering assistance from a backpack supposedly containing a fix-a-flat kit.

Sergeant Jonathan Epperson of the Harris County Police detailed the encounter: “As he was helping them change the tire, that suspect said, ‘Hey, I need another fix a flat,’ and actually left but prior to leaving, he entered the vehicle and took the money from the victim. We’re working with the banks on all 10 of these ongoing investigations. We just want the community to be aware of what’s going on.”

Subsequent investigation revealed the suspect had monitored the victim’s bank visit, punctured the victim’s tire, and followed them after departure.

Harris County Police urge anyone with information to contact the local police department and request to speak with a detective. Tips can also be anonymously submitted through Crime Stoppers via phone – 1-800-222-TIPS (8477), or online.

To prevent falling victim to “bank jugging,” the Harris County Police recommends:

  • Being vigilant of surroundings outside banks.
  • Concealing cash and bank-related items discreetly.
  • Varying routines regarding banking and cash withdrawals.
  • Securing vehicles by locking doors and concealing valuables.
  • Reporting suspicious activity promptly to law enforcement.

Residents are advised to remain cautious and proactive to mitigate the risks associated with this emerging criminal tactic.

Dodgers Interpreter Fired Amidst Allegations of Wire Transfers to Gambling Debts From Shohei Ohtani’s Bank Account

In a startling turn of events, the Los Angeles Dodgers terminated the employment of Ippei Mizuhara, the interpreter for Shohei Ohtani, on Wednesday afternoon. The decision followed inquiries regarding wire transfers totaling at least $4.5 million from Ohtani’s bank account to a bookmaking operation, triggering a sequence of revelations and denials.

Mizuhara, a close friend and interpreter for Ohtani, allegedly incurred substantial gambling debts to a Southern California bookmaker currently under federal scrutiny, as disclosed by multiple sources to ESPN. The unraveling of events commenced with reporters probing the nature of wire transfers, leading to a complex narrative involving Ohtani’s involvement in settling Mizuhara’s gambling liabilities.

Initially, a spokesperson for Ohtani informed ESPN that the wire transfers were intended to cover Mizuhara’s gambling debts, presenting Mizuhara for a detailed interview on Tuesday night. However, as ESPN prepared to publish the story, the spokesperson retracted Mizuhara’s account, stating that Ohtani had been the victim of a significant theft and that the matter was being referred to the authorities.

The ensuing statement from Berk Brettler LLP asserted Ohtani’s innocence and denounced any implication of wrongdoing on his part. The abrupt reversal left Mizuhara’s role in the saga ambiguous, with questions arising about his alleged involvement in the wire transfers and subsequent attempts to repay the debts.

Amidst the unfolding controversy, federal investigators are scrutinizing the operations of a Southern California bookmaker linked to the wire transfers from Ohtani’s account. The payments were directed to an associate of the bookmaker, casting a shadow of suspicion over Mizuhara’s purported gambling activities and Ohtani’s unwitting involvement.

While Ohtani’s camp denies any knowledge of Mizuhara’s gambling debts, Mizuhara’s narrative initially portrayed Ohtani as facilitating the wire transfers to settle his debts. However, Mizuhara recanted his statements on Wednesday, asserting Ohtani’s innocence in the matter and claiming sole responsibility for the gambling debts.

The developments have cast a pall over Mizuhara’s professional association with Ohtani, whose interpreter he has been since the star’s move to the United States in 2018. Mizuhara’s dual role as a friend and interpreter has made him a familiar figure in baseball circles, accompanying Ohtani in various capacities both on and off the field.

Mizuhara’s termination from the Dodgers marks a significant fallout from the scandal, with implications for both his professional career and Ohtani’s public image. As the investigation unfolds, the true extent of Mizuhara’s involvement and the ramifications for Ohtani remain uncertain, pending further developments in the ongoing federal probe.

Heart Health Warning: Intermittent Fasting Linked to Increased Risk of Cardiovascular Mortality

0

While intermittent fasting has garnered attention for its potential weight loss benefits, a recent analysis presented at the American Heart Association’s scientific sessions raises concerns about its impact on heart health. Contrary to previous beliefs, researchers from Shanghai Jiao Tong University School of Medicine in China discovered a troubling association between time-restricted eating and an elevated risk of death from cardiovascular disease.

The study, presented on Monday, suggests that individuals who restrict their food consumption to less than eight hours per day face a staggering 91% higher risk of cardiovascular mortality over an eight-year period compared to those who eat within a 12 to 16-hour window.

Based on data from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ention’s National Health and Nutrition Examination Survey spanning from 2003 to 2018, the analysis surveyed approximately 20,000 adults. It underscores some of the first research probing the link between time-restricted eating and cardiovascular outcomes.

However, co-author Victor Wenze Zhong cautions against drawing definitive conclusions solely from this study. While short-term intermittent fasting may yield weight loss benefits and improve cardiometabolic health, Zhong advises against prolonged fasting regimens, urging individuals to exercise caution.

Intermittent fasting encompasses various schedules, from restricting eating to a six to eight-hour period per day to the “5:2 diet,” involving limited calorie intake on two nonconsecutive days weekly. Despite its growing popularity, the study underscores the need for comprehensive understanding and further investigation into its potential implications for cardiovascular health.

While the findings offer valuable insights, experts emphasize the need for caution and context. Dr. Benjamin Horne, a research professor at Intermountain Health, highlights the short-term stress fasting imposes on the body, potentially increasing the risk of heart problems, especially among vulnerable groups.

However, Dr. Francisco Lopez-Jimenez of Mayo Clinic suggests that the timing of fasting may influence its effects, urging a nuanced approach to interpreting the research. Amidst the ongoing debate, Dr. Pam Taub of UC San Diego Health underscores the diverse experiences of individuals practicing intermittent fasting, emphasizing its potential benefits observed in her patients.

As discussions surrounding intermittent fasting continue, experts advocate for a balanced understanding and further research to elucidate its complexities and potential implications for heart health.
